选择特殊符号
选择搜索类型
请输入搜索
书名:给水工程毕业设计范例 | |
作者: 杜茂安,张怡 | 责编:贾学斌 |
I S B N:978-7-5603-3905-4 | 定价:35.00元 |
出版日期:2013.05 | 开本:16 |
所属丛书:高等学校"十二五"规划教材 | 页数:200 |
图书分类:C.建筑.市政与环境工程类 | 中图分类:环境科学、安全科学 |
统地介绍了给排水科学与工程专业的《华北地区东方市的给水工程》毕业设计计算内容、计算方法和步骤。主要内容包括:取水工程、水处理和输配水工程。 全书共分10章,由结论、输配水工程设计计算、方案技术经济比较与方案校核、地表水取水工程设计、地表水净水厂设计、地表水二泵站设计、地下水取水工程设计、地下水净水厂设计、地下水二泵站设计和设计总概算及制水成本构成,书后附设计图。
可作为给排水科学与工程、环境工程专业规划教材,也可供上述专业本科毕业设计参考。
摘要
Abstract
第1章绪论
1.1城市概况
1.2原始资料
1.2.1设计题目
1.2.2原始资料
1.3毕业设计内容
1.3.1城市给水管网的扩大初步设计
1.3.2取水构筑物设计
1—3.3净水厂技术设计的工艺部分
1.3.4二级泵站技术设计的工艺部分
1.3.5城市给水工程的总概算和成本估计
第2章输配水工程设计计算
2.1输配水管线布置
2.1—1输配水管渠线路选择
2.1.2配水管网布置
2.2供水方案的选择
2.3统一给水方案设计计算
2.3.1最高日用水量计算
2.3.2全市最高日逐时用水量
2.3.3全市最高日消防时用水量计算
2.3.4清水池容积计算
2.3.5管网定线
2.3.6管网水力计算
2.3.7管网平差
2.3.8输水管水力计算
2.4分质供水方案设计计算
2.4.1概述
2.4.2最高日用水量
2.4.3全市最高日逐时用水量
2.4.4全市最高日消防时用水量计算
2.4.5清水池容积计算
2.4.6管网定线
2.4.7管网水力计算
2.4.8管网平差
2.4.9输水管水力计算
2.5多水源供水方案设计计算
2.5.1概述
2.5.2最高日用水量
2.5.3全市最高Et逐时用水量
2.5.4全市最高日消防时用水量计算
2.5.5清水池容积计算
2.5.6管网定线
2.5.7管网水力计算
2.5.8管网平差
2.5.9输水管水力计算
2.6二泵站水泵扬程估算
2.6.1各区服务水头计算
2.6.2统一供水方案二泵站水泵扬程
2.6.3多水源供水方案二泵站水泵扬程
2.7本章小结
第3章方案技术经济比较与方案校核
3.1统一供水方案经济估算
3.2分质供水方案经济估算
3.3多水源供水方案经济估算
3.4供水方案的选择
3.5多水源供水方案管网校核
3.5.1消防校核
3.5.2事故校核
3.6管网等水压线的绘制
3.7本章小结
第4章地表水取水工程设计
4.1水源的选取
4.2地表水取水构筑物位置和形式的选择
4.2.1地表水取水构筑物位置的选择
4.2.2地表水取水构筑物形式的确定
4.3进水问的设计计算
4.3.1概述
4.3.2进水孑L和格栅的设计
4.3.3格网的设计
4.3.4进水间平面布置
4.3.5进水间高程布置与计算
4.3.6格网起吊设备的计算
4.3.7排泥与启闭设备
4.3.8防冰措施
4.4地表水取水泵房的设计计算
4.4.1设计流量和扬程的确定
4.4.2初选水泵和电机
4.4.3吸水管路和压水管路的计算
4.4.4水头损失的计算和扬程的校核
4.4.5泵房高程布置
4.4.6附属设备
4.5本章小结
第5章地表水净水厂设计
5.1厂址的选择
5.2工艺流程的选择
5.2.1原始资料
5.2.2主要设计依据
5.2.3水厂设计流量
5.2.4工艺流程选择
5.3加药间设计
5.3.1混凝剂投量
5.3.2混凝剂的投加
5.3.3预氧化系统设计
5.3.4加药间和药库的设计
5.4混合设备设计
5.5反应池设计
5.5.1设计水量
5.5.2反应池形式及设计参数的确定
5.5.3池体的设计
5.5.4水头损失的计算
5.5.5 GT值计算
5.5.6反应池排泥系统设计
5.6沉淀池设计
5.6.1设计参数的确定
5.6.2池体尺寸计算
5.6.3进水系统设计
5.6.4出水系统设计
5.6.5沉淀池斜管选择
5.6.6沉淀池排泥系统设计
5.6.7核算
5.7滤池设计
5.7.1设计参数
5.7.2池体设计
5.7.3进出水系统设计
5.7.4反冲洗及出水系统设计
5.7.5过滤系统设计
5.7.6排水系统设计
5.7.7反冲洗水的供给
5.7.8反冲洗空气的供给
5.8加氯问设计
5.8.1加氯点的选择
5.8.2加氯量的计算
5.8.3加氯设备的选择
5.8.4加氯间和氯库的布置
5.8.5辅助设备
5.9清水池设计
5.9.1清水池平面尺寸确定
5.9.2配管及布置
5.9.3清水池的布置
5.10水厂平面与高程布置
5.10.I水厂平面布置
5.10.2水厂高程布置
5.11本章小结
第6章地表水二泵站设计
第7章地下水取水工程设计
第8章地下水净水厂设计
第9章地下水二泵站设计
第10章设计总概算及制水成本
结论
附录
参考文献
致谢 2100433B
给水工程毕业设计指导书
给 水 工 程 毕 业 设 计 指 导 书 (给水排水工程专业四年制本科生用)
下面将给出使用mmap()的一个范例:范例1给出两个进程通过映射普通文件实现共享内存通信;系统调用 mmap()有许多有趣的地方,下面是通过mmap()映射普通文件实现进程间的通信的范例,我们通过该范例来说明mmap()实现共享内存的特点及注意事项。
范例1:两个进程通过映射普通文件实现共享内存通信
范例1包含两个子程序:map_normalfile1.c及map_normalfile2.c。编译两个程序,可执行文件分别为 map_normalfile1及map_normalfile2。两个程序通过命令行参数指定同一个文件来实现共享内存方式的进程间通信。 map_normalfile1试图打开命令行参数指定的一个普通文件,把该文件映射到进程的地址空间,并对映射后的地址空间进行写操作。 map_normalfile2把命令行参数指定的文件映射到进程地址空间,然后对映射后的地址空间执行读操作。这样,两个进程通过命令行参数指定同一个文件来实现共享内存方式的进程间通信。
下面是两个程序代码:
map_normalfile1.c 首先定义了一个people数据结构,(在这里采用数据结构的方式是因为,共享内存区的数据往往是有固定格式的,这由通信的各个进程决定,采用结构的方式有普遍代表性)。map_normfile1首先打开或创建一个文件,并把文件的长度设置为5个people结构大小。然后从mmap()的返回地址开始,设置了10个people结构。然后,进程睡眠10秒钟,等待其他进程映射同一个文件,最后解除映射。
map_normfile2.c只是简单的映射一个文件,并以people数据结构的格式从mmap()返回的地址处读取10个people结构,并输出读取的值,然后解除映射。
分别把两个程序编译成可执行文件map_normalfile1和map_normalfile2后,在一个终端上先运行./map_normalfile1 /tmp/test_shm,程序输出结果如下:
initialize over
umap ok
在map_normalfile1输出initialize over 之后,输出umap ok之前,在另一个终端上运行map_normalfile2 /tmp/test_shm,将会产生如下输出(为了节省空间,输出结果为稍作整理后的结果):
name: b age 20; name: c age 21; name: d age 22; name: e age 23; name: f age 24;
name: g age 25; name: h age 26; name: I age 27; name: j age 28; name: k age 29;
在map_normalfile1 输出umap ok后,运行map_normalfile2则输出如下结果:
name: b age 20; name: c age 21; name: d age 22; name: e age 23; name: f age 24;
name: age 0; name: age 0; name: age 0; name: age 0; name: age 0;
从程序的运行结果中可以得出的结论
1、 最终被映射文件的内容的长度不会超过文件本身的初始大小,即映射不能改变文件的大小;
2、可以用于进程通信的有效地址空间大小大体上受限于被映射文件的大小,但不完全受限于文件大小。打开文件被截短为5个people结构大小,而在 map_normalfile1中初始化了10个people数据结构,在恰当时候(map_normalfile1输出initialize over 之后,输出umap ok之前)调用map_normalfile2会发现map_normalfile2将输出全部10个people结构的值,后面将给出详细讨论。
注:在linux中,内存的保护是以页为基本单位的,即使被映射文件只有一个字节大小,内核也会为映射分配一个页面大小的内存。当被映射文件小于一个页面大小时,进程可以对从mmap()返回地址开始的一个页面大小进行访问,而不会出错;但是,如果对一个页面以外的地址空间进行访问,则导致错误发生,后面将进一步描述。因此,可用于进程间通信的有效地址空间大小不会超过文件大小及一个页面大小的和。
3、文件一旦被映射后,调用mmap()的进程对返回地址的访问是对某一内存区域的访问,暂时脱离了磁盘上文件的影响。所有对mmap()返回地址空间的操作只在内存中有意义,只有在调用了munmap()后或者msync()时,才把内存中的相应内容写回磁盘文件,所写内容仍然不能超过文件的大小。
munmap执行相反的操作,删除特定地址区域的对象映射,基于文件的映射,在mmap和munmap执行过程的任何时刻,被映射文件的st_atime可能被更新。如果st_atime字段在前述的情况下没有得到更新,首次对映射区的第一个页索引时会更新该字段的值。用PROT_WRITE 和 MAP_SHARED标志建立起来的文件映射其st_ctime 和 st_mtime,在对映射区写入之后但在msync()通过MS_SYNC 和 MS_ASYNC两个标志调用之前会被更新
范例1支架
范例2削笔刀盒
范例3烟灰缸
范例4杯子
范例5泵盖
范例6塑料凳
范例7BP机壳
范例8涡轮
范例9外壳
范例10塑料支架
范例11儿童玩具篮
范例12笔帽
范例13旋钮
范例14剃须刀盖
范例15打火机壳
范例16在曲面上创建实体文字
范例17泵体
范例18减速箱
范例19肥皂盒
范例20饮水机开关
范例21插头
范例22吊钩
范例23订书机上盖
范例24饮料瓶
范例25吸尘器上盖
范例26自行车座
范例27参数化设计蜗杆
范例28扣件
范例29轴承
范例30儿童喂药器
范例31CPU散热器
范例32衣架的设计
范例33飞盘玩具
范例34储钱罐
范例35鼠标的自顶向下设计
总结了作者多年设计经验和教学心得
系统讲解了SolidWorks的要点和难点
实例众多.实用性强
附大容量、高品质多媒体视频教学光盘
……
《SolidWorks产品设计范例》可作为高等学校机械类各专业学生的CAD课程教材,也可作为机械工程专业人员的SolidWorks自学教材和参考书籍。
《SolidWorks产品设计范例》附光盘一张,光盘中制作了《SolidWorks产品设计范例》的同步视频录像文件(近7个小时),另外,光盘还包含《SolidWorks产品设计范例》所有的教案文件、范例文件等。